What the Data Says About Katherene

The Social Security Administration has registered 492 babies named Katherene between 1901 and 2004, spanning 104 consecutive years of U.S. birth records. As a girl's name, Katherene currently falls outside the top 1,000 girls' names for 2004. The name reached its historical peak in 1922, when 19 babies received it in a single year.

Decade-level aggregation shows that Katherene performed strongest in the 1920s, accumulating 121 births during that ten-year window. Across the 11 decades of recorded activity, Katherene shows a clear decline from its mid-century high.

These figures derive from SSA's annual national and state-level name files, which include any name appearing at least five times in a given year or state-year; names below that threshold are suppressed for privacy and therefore excluded from the totals shown here. The 492 total represents a lower bound — actual usage may be higher in years or states where the count fell below the disclosure floor.
